Seattle Coffee Works 111 Pike Street Blend Seattle Coffee Works' house blend combines coffees from four origins. Colombian serves as a balanced base. Yirgacheffe contributes a hint of blueberry. Kenya adds a red-wine note. Finally, Guatemalan makes for a lemon-zesty finish. Beautifully sweet in a latte, this blend also makes a smooth cup of drip or press pot. $12.45
Seattle Coffee Works Mellow Seattle To a base of Colombia with hints of Mandarin, we add the blueberry flavor of Ethiopian Harrar and a bit of Brazil nuttiness.The result is caramely blend with good body and beautiful high notes. $12.95

Costa Rica Tres Nubes "West Valley" This Costa Rican is a beautifully bright example of some of the best of Central American coffees. Hints of citrus-y sweetness and a bit of pleasant mustiness combine for a perfect cup of morning coffee (drip or press pot). Guaranteed to wake you up! Also makes a surprisingly intense espresso shot. $11.95
Seattle Coffee Works Colombia Huila "Monserrate"
(Direct Trade)
Medium roasted Colombian of the finest quality. This direct-relationship coffee is grown in Monserrate, a small 28-family community in the region of Huila, Colombia. Delicate floral notes, balanced by fruity wine sweetness. Medium body, perfect drip or press pot. $12.45
Seattle Coffee Works Kenya Mancha Peaberry(Single Estate) This Estate Kenya Peaberry Coffee is yet another shining example of the amazing fruity juicyness in Kenyan coffees in general. Highly rated, this is the best Kenyan we know. $12.95
Seattle Coffee Works Nicaragua "Florencia" A big body, some earthiness, deep chocolate notes, and just a slightly citrusy finish make this an all-around favorite. $12.45
Seattle Coffee Works Yirgacheffe Kochere Hints of cherry galore! We swear that we didn't pour a bucket of cherry flavor on this coffee. It just naturally is chock-full of this amazing flavor. Add to it a mild acidity and a light body, and you have one big personality coffee. A rare find! This should be rated at least at 90 in the coffee rating scheme. $12.95
Seattle Coffee Works Harrar Longberry Sweet blueberry notes define this coffee. There is a good amount of complexity but not so much as to confuse the tongue. A fine cup of drip coffee both press pot and filter. $12.45
Seattle Coffee Works Sumatra (Mandheling) An old-time favorite! Hints of deep chocolate linger for a long bold finish. Great as a drip or press pot. $12.45
Seattle Coffee Works Brazil Cerrado Beautifully nutty in the cup a brightness unique to the best Brazils. With its medium body, this coffee refreshes and pleases to no end. Great as a drip or press pot. $12.45
Seven Roasters Espresso Huli Sean Lee (Seven Roaster's owner and head roaster) added Brazil to the tried and true blend of Mexico, Guatemala, and Sumatra. This blend has some serious kick to it. The Brazil nuttiness is especially tasty in milk. Makes a great cup of espresso, and a tasty and somewhat unusual cup of drip coffee / press pot. $13.95
Borogove Cremona Cremona is a symphonic blend of coffee from four of the world’s great growing regions: Central America, South America, East Africa and the Islands of Southeast Asia.  It is blended for a big, full, rich, round flavor.  Sweet chocolate notes predominate, complemented by myriad aromatic notes: wood, earth and herbs linger long in the mouth for a memorably fine finish. Makes great espresso and lattes. Also a great drip / press pot. $14.45
Vashon Coffee Company Espresso Velutto (Organic, Fair Trade) The fruity Organic Ethiopian Harar and Yirgacheffe are the dominating ingredients in this beautiful medium roast. Organic Mexican adds spicy sweetness and hints of chocolate. Organic Sumatra rounds off this blend with earthy bass notes and a smooth finish. Great espresso, also makes a wonderful short cappuccino or latte. Great as an afternoon drip or press pot. $14.45
Mukilteo Kayak Blend (Organic) This simple blend of dark-roasted Peruvian and Guatemalan coffees is appropriately named to remind us of sitting around a fire before a long day of hiking in the wilderness. Smoky, notes of chocolate, hints of lemon-zesty Guatemalan, but in all a true cowboy (pardon the non-pc-ness) blend. We can't decide whether we like it better as an Espresso blend or as a beautiful press pot. Of course, also makes a nice drip coffee. $13.95
